AC was upgraded last year to R134, blows really cold then cycles off, then comes back on later, any ideas? I thought the system might have a leak and low on R134, but it blows really cold when it is on?????
 
It only cycles when pressure on the high side (or was it low side) is low so you might want to check if low on refrigirator or not before doing anything else, or they can use a "sniffer" to see if you have any leaks without much effortr.
 
If the system cycles off/on a lot, its usually an indication that the system is low on charge, most likely from a leak. I've seen this a lot with older cars that have been converted, if the conversion was not done right, there could be multiple small leaks, but if there is dye in the system, you could use a UV light & yellow glasses to trace down the leak and/or an A/C system sniffer, but those can be expensive.

On a side note: The R134a is a conversion, not really considered an upgrade on a system designed for R12. An R12 system with R12 will always blow colder than a R12 system thats been converted to R134a.
